The Spindlecrest bike-share rebalancing planner serves its route-optimization endpoint to any caller on the internal network; the intended operator-role check was dropped during the Ketterly refactor. Routes include dock fill levels and driver shift windows, which we treat as operationally sensitive. Patch restores the role gate and adds a regression test. Requesting security review sign-off before the fix ships to depots. The build trace token for the candidate artifact is below.

pipeline stamp: htk31_f769b577b3028a4e9958e5bb8d1259a

Subject: Gatewick flag framework — partner rollout

Hi all,

The Gatewick rollout framework is ready for partner integration. Flags ship in three rings: internal, partner, general. Release manager approves ring promotion via the console; partners see changes within five minutes. Rollback is a single toggle, no redeploy. Ring promotion API calls should be made with the bearer token below.

login token, bagug-kafop: eyJhbGciOiJIUzI1NiIsInR5cCI6IkpXVCJ9.eyJzdWIiOiIcMLov2In0.Z5RLDIfp

// Digest scheduler client for Mailloom's batch email pipeline.
// Digests are batched hourly; the scheduler dedupes recipients across
// queues before handoff to the send tier. Discussed at last week's sync:
// we moved scheduling off cron to the internal Tempo service for retry
// semantics. This client authenticates to Tempo with the key below.

API key for yahig-tadup: kto7_ubizbYm

Subject: Tollbrook Term Sheet — Board Review

Board,

Tollbrook Dynamics delivered their term sheet Friday. Headline: minority stake, board observer seat, exclusivity in the Averlane market for three years. Valuation is acceptable; exclusivity clause is not. Counsel is drafting a counter. We need board sign-off before Thursday's call. The confidential negotiating position is set out below.

confidential, yajof-fawep: The renewal with Quenaelax Holdings closes at $20 million a year, 20 percent above the last contract. Project Holix slips by two quarters because of the staffing delay.